
One major drawback of using contact lenses would be to remember just how many days have passed since the contacts have last been replaced. For those with a less than impressive memory streak, here is the interestingly named Countact Lens Case that does the remembering on your behalf. All you need to do is set the duration to either 14 or 30 days, press the ‘Counter’ button and you’re good to go. The backlit LCD display will show just how many more days you have left before the next contact lens change. When expired, the Countact Lens Case will emit a beep via its built-in speaker as a reminder. At $34 a pop, this is one of the more practical gifts this Christmas.
